拼多多-暑期实习-前端面经

4.21 一面

手撕三道,第二题大数相加,第三题lastPromise:要求传入一个Iterable参数,返回最后一个成功的promise,失败的跳过,若都失败返回"all promise is reject"

用例:

lastPromise([new Promise(res => {setTimeOut(() => res(9), 2000)}),
			 1,
			 new Promise(rej => {rej(2)}),
			 ]).then(console.log).catch(console.log)
// 将输出9

4.27 二面

一些基础八股(不难)

进阶八股:SSR,打包方法【答得不太好】

做题:

  • 事件循环输出顺序
  • 实现串行执行10个从后端取数的操作(已给),返回他们的和
  • css实现把一个20px边长的正方形在大container中居中
  • 算法题:合并两个有序列表(尽量在nums1中原地修改)

面试体验:面试官会引导思考,比较给机会,哪里答错了可能会简单讲解之后让你修改一次

全部评论
有没有大佬知道忘记点拼多多二面邀请同意了怎么办嘛
点赞 回复 分享
发布于 昨天 21:42 江西
点赞 回复 分享
发布于 05-01 21:02 山东
会有三面吗
点赞 回复 分享
发布于 04-29 19:15 日本

相关推荐

昨天 15:26
已编辑
门头沟学院 前端工程师
##实习进度记录# #快手前端# 一面 4.24 1h1. 介绍2. 项目:出于什么样的原因做的都是自己完成的吗功能、大文件分片、后端验证、部署、持久化优化项目怎么配置的跨域缓存做了什么部署服务器和域名用的哪家的?docker数据卷3. 八股:强/协商缓存CSS盒模型JS数据类型、判断原型链查找对象属性描述符判断属性是对象自己的而不是原型链上的对象怎么禁止修改属性Vue响应式Vue2数组处理,新增删除属性处理React hooks,用过哪些,注意事项函数式组件怎么写,我:写个函数,里面写hooks,返回jsx,用的地方写成标签的形式(面试官突然笑了,我也不知道在笑啥,于是也跟着笑)页面性能指标flex居中,flex表示什么属性的组合CSS相对单位4. 反问:业务:支付相关转正:未知,往年50%+技术栈:Vue2老项目转React,React新项目建议:目前组内主要是React,建议多准备一下项目和React,二面可能更注重。(这算过了?)实习生会不会own一些挑战性的项目:看能力5. 手写题:闭包有序数组合并链式访问表格组件(Vue)----------------------------------------------------------------------------------------二面 5.7 50min(暑期面试体验最好的)开始先给我介绍10min业务:(1)短视频:快手、抖音、微信视频号。面试官:你大学在广州,现在的话南方用抖音比较多;我:我家在北方,用快手多(2)电商:阿里拼多多京东抖音快手,过了一遍(3)组内:北京杭州都有,电商支付都有,说了好多自我介绍项目:选一个介绍,问了一堆暑期唯一让共享屏幕看代码的听过哪些前端的其他东西:signal、webassembly、rolldown、跨端AI怎么用的反问:技术栈您最近是不是加班比较多建议:基础不错,建议把所学的体系化归纳总结等等等(以上只是我的建议,不一定对)如果过了真感觉有点对不住面试官了,去是肯定去不了了三个小时后约三面,拒了
点赞 评论 收藏
分享
04-25 15:51
华南理工大学
总结下来,其实自己这次暑期虽然投递了很多,但约面较少,进了美团也许是运气因素。        美团:第一次二面挂,二面基本没问前端,全是计算机的内容(科班应该没问题),大致内容如下:                 面试官:学过操作系统和数据结构吗?         我:不是计算机专业,了解的很浅。         面试官:没关系,没学过,在我的引导下应该也能答出来,说说操作系统怎么进行内存管理的?         我:(把看过的一点八股都说了)虚拟内存,分段分表这些浅层概念。         面试官:具体是怎么划分的?用哪一种数据结构划分?这个管理的过程是什么样的?         我:答了一点点后,就说不会了。         面试官:好吧,那么现在假设有一段内存,你准备用什么方法分配?         我:按照指定的大小,将起始地址设置为key,内存大小或者其它必要信息设置为value,使用一个map结构来实现。         后面有点忘了,就提出一些问题,比如有的需要内存小,有的需要内存大,这个就存在分配问题。         虽然面试官后面也在引导,但确实没啥概念,最后感觉也没答出来。         面试官:说说TCP和UDP的区别吧?         我:八股说了。         面试官:既然你说到了拥塞避免和流量控制,详细讲讲过程。         我:答了每次应答会回传一个值控制滑动窗口大小以及慢启动,拥塞避免,快重传这些八股。         面试官:对回传这块深入询问。         我:浮于表层的我,又答不出来了。         面试官:尝试引导,以堵车为例子,什么交警如何知道堵车以及后续怎么控制拥堵程度。         我:尝试作答,但感觉没答到面试官想要的点子上。                   面试官:你为什么要做这个项目?价值在哪里?(大致这个意思)         我:额,这两个是学习项目,没有上线,学习前端开发的流程。         面试官:好的,说说项目的亮点吧。         我:说了虚拟列表的几种实现方法,轮播图以及电梯导航原生实现的三种方法。(可能这里提了自己在网上找了多种                 实现方式,面试官觉得没有自己的思考?)         面试官:这几种实现方式也是网上常规的,也就是都是网上寻找的现成方案吗?         我:额,确实主要是以网上的方案为主体进行更改的。         面试官:你还觉得你项目有什么难点吗?         我:这时候已经有点晕头了, 说这几个点确实都是网上找到方案做的,还说这些也不难         面试官:好的,进入下一个阶段。         面试官:现在可以做一个智力题吗?         我说,可以换一个算法题吗?(开始介绍时,说了这个阶段是算法或者智力题,完全没做过那啥杯子倒水的智力题,就说换成算法吧)          面试官:好的,但我这个可不是leetcode上的那种算法题          题目大致如下:相亲市场上有很多男女,让你设计一个算法,每轮随机进行配对,然后不允许配对已经配对过的,          每轮打印结果。                     因为时间不够,就说了下思路,把男女进行标号,用一个列表存储已经排列的男女,例如[男1-女1,男1-女2]          后面问优化方案以及时间复杂度。          答完后面试官说没有答到每轮随机的设计方式。(可能当时听题目没太注意)          问你用过AI辅助开发吗?怎么用?用的chat还是Agent模式?           反问。(工作日后被捞)            第二轮美团一面:(主要还是AI)           1.先问了下项目中某个功能的具体实现?问的蛮细,问的蛮久,比如这个组件传哪些参数,怎么动态生成。           2.useCallback useMemo Memo           3.跨域           4.用的什么AI工具开发前端? 为什么用cursor?           5.提到了agent模式,怎么用mcp工具查看选中DOM,怎么用AI检查内存泄漏,AI辅助开发的技巧有什么?           6.要求打字结合说明,就说我用AI尝试开发一个苹果时钟APP,过程有哪些关键。比如明确AI的身份,要一步步的来               把你需要的组件的大致结构传给AI,入参哪些,什么样的逻辑。(这部分就是主观的,完全看你平时怎么用AI辅            助来答就行)           7.后面基本都是AI的一些浅层知识,哪几种大模型,区别,适用于哪些场景这些。           美团二面:(全是AI)           也是问AI辅助开发有哪些诀窍,你会怎么使用,然后遇到一些问题怎么解决?                      中途提了一嘴动态表单,然后面试官就给了一个需求让现场打开共享用AI辅助开发一个动态表单。(这个基本占据大量面试时间,最后没写出来。(cursor其实真没用多少,尤其是准备面试这段时间)            把你每次的提示词复制发送给面试官。                        就问你怎么了解AI大模型发展? 用过哪些? 怎么用? 以及大模型在哪些地方有缺陷?以及刚才你用AI辅助开发哪里存在问题?            反问。(流程没变超多天,最后OC,感觉是前面的人鸽了很多?)                        就以我以及身边的人而言,感觉确实前端开发对于大模型的应用很关注。            以我舍友为例,面的某杭州大厂,一面1小时,简单问了点八股和项目后,看到他的研究方向跟大模型有关,就畅谈了半小时的研究方向和大模型; 二面1小时,应该全部是聊大模型;最后通过,说是部门最近想搞一个跟大模型结合的内容,想招点懂些这个的人进来可以搞点有意思的东西。(同学做的是这方面研究,但论文尚未投出,所以我觉得如果是冲算法岗位但确实大厂神仙打架进不去,可以尝试开发学点,当下大模型风口也许不问你开发很深的东西就让你通过了,后续进去也是做和大模型相关的东西,也许算是算法爷的曲线救国?)
点赞 评论 收藏
分享
评论
4
17
分享

创作者周榜

更多
牛客网
牛客企业服务